Abstract
Plant cell cultures cultivated in darkness and subsequently irradiated with continuous blue light have the capacity to develop functional ch loroplasts from leucoplast like precursors. This process is accompanie d by chlorophyll-synthesis and expression of plastid structural genes. The nature of regulatory factors related to the specific gene activat ion is uncertain and approaches for their evaluation are described. Ex emplarily, events connected to the regulation of a blue light induced gene are introduced. The significance as well as a possible interactio n of light and phytohormone signal transduction pathways is discussed.
